NBA owners made no decision Tuesday after a lengthy debate about moving next year’s All-Star Game from Charlotte because of North Carolina’s law limiting protection for LGBT people.

Commissioner Adam Silver said no vote was taken at the Board of Governors meeting, but the league realizes a decision has to come fairly quickly. He said he was personally disappointed North Carolina legislators didn’t modify the law enough in recent weeks to make the discussion moot. “We feel this law is inconsistent with the core values of the league,” Silver said.
